ruby - "<<"中的 "1000 << 16"在ruby中是什么意思?

标签 ruby int operators

ruby 中“1000 << 16”中的“<<”是什么意思?

我知道对于字符串 <<可用于串联,但我不明白它对 int 有何作用秒。有人可以解释一下吗?

最佳答案

关于ruby - "<<"中的 "1000 << 16"在ruby中是什么意思?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6258448/

相关文章:

ruby - 使用 ruby​​ watir 测试 html 表格元素是否存在

ruby - 安装 ruby​​installer-1.9.2-p136 后运行 watir 脚本时出现错误 "msvcrt-ruby18.dll is missing"

php - ~ 位运算符(波浪号)的作用是什么

java - 反转 int 溢出

c - 为什么以下 C 代码中的后递减运算符没有按预期工作? (具有 7 的值)

python - python中 `//`运算符的目的是什么?

ruby - 如何从 rake 文件中的命令行决定我的浏览器(*firefox,*ie)?

ruby-on-rails - 尝试测试嵌套属性时 Rspec 抛出的未知属性错误

c++ - `int` 与 `double` 的问题 - 为什么我的程序不工作?

UTF-8 字符串的 java.lang.NumberFormatException